Love and Relationships

Posted by wisdomtree on December 3, 2008

Bible study prepared by Samuel Thambusamy

A husband should love his wife as much as Christ loved the church and gave his life for it. He made the church holy by the power of his word, and he made it pure by washing it with water. Christ did this, so that he would have a glorious and holy church, without faults or spots or wrinkles or any other flaws. In the same way, a husband should love his wife as much as he loves himself. A husband who loves his wife shows that he loves himself. None of us hate our own bodies. We provide for them and take good care of them, just as Christ does for the church, because we are each part of his body. As the Scriptures say, “A man leaves his father and mother to get married, and he becomes like one person with his wife.” This is a great mystery, but I understand it to mean Christ and his church. So each husband should love his wife as much as he loves himself, and each wife should respect her husband. (Eph 5:25-33 CEV)

Questions for further reflection

  1. What is this passage about?
  2. What does the phrase, “ love your wife” mean? How does relationships (loving your wife) connect with spirituality?
  3. Male superiority is expressed differently in society. What are the cultural expressions in support of male superiority in your context/s? What do you think about them? How do you respond to notions of male superiority?
  4. Why should a husband love his wife? Share one thing that you do to show that you love your wife?
  5. How does Christ love the Church? Why do you think Paul compares the husband-wife relationship with  Christ-Church relationship?
  6. What is God telling you/me through the passage? What am I/are you going to do in response to God’s Word?
